Rainbows Ireland is a free, voluntary service for children experiencing loss following bereavement and parental separation.
It provides group support for children and young people throughout Ireland through a series of tailored programmes. They approached us to work on their programme for teenagers dealing with issues relating to bereavement or parental separation. Following the completion of that project, we were asked to design ‘Conversations with Children’, Rainbows Ireland's back to school programme to help children to adjust to life back in school after several months at home during the Covid-19 crisis.
Each programme deals with heightened emotions so the challenge for us was to ensure that the design was sensitive to the topics.

The Approach
Each programme is broken into a series of workshops working through topics such as how to help young people understand and name or recognise their feelings; that change can be overwhelming and to begin to understand the changes that have occurred and navigate through them and simple coping techniques to foster a process of coping, adjusting and adapting to what has happened in their lives.
Each workshop runs through a sensitive topic shared through a series of activities – and each activity requires a written and verbal response. During the process, they reflect on their journey so it felt a journal format would be the best solution - making each activity full of doodles and making the content easy for each young person to engage with.

The Execution
To help make the journal engaging for its target audience we worked closely with illustrator Aoife Dooley who created a suite of illustrations which fit each topic and activity.
With a mixed format of doodles, character illustrations with a range of faces to demonstrate different emotions and a bespoke font – the journal is brought to life and helps get the balance between making the information easy for the participant to understand but also dealing with the sensitivity of each topic.



Rainbows Ireland's 'Conversations with Children' programme is a resource framework that was developed to support children on their return to school as the COVID-19 restrictions lift. Each session in the resource looks at helping children digest what they have experienced during the last few months and gives them the space to begin to make sense of what has been happening and understand many of the feelings and emotions that they may have experienced.
Using the same visual styling as the teenage programme, this resource adapts the bright colours and doodle style to create a series of activities that engage its audience, encouraging them to express their feelings about the impact of Covid-19 on their lives.
